A picture is blurred. You moved the camera when
pressing the shutter release button.
Hold the camera with your elbows tight
on your body. Or use a tripod.
P. 2 5
When shooting in a dark place (ex.
indoor), the shutter speed slows down
and pictures become easily blurred.
Use the flash. Or, raise the ISO
sensitivity.
P. 3 3
P.55
The flash does not fire. Or
the flash cannot recharge.
The Shooting Mode is set to R (Multi-
Shot) or 3 (Movie).
Switch the Shooting Mode to 5 (Still
Image).
P. 1 2
The flash is set to (Flash Off).
Deselect the Flash Off with the F button. P.33
Batteries are running low. If using alkaline batteries, replace the
batteries with a new set. If using
rechargeable batteries, recharge or use
the AC Adapter.
P. 1 6
Even though the flash
fired, the picture is dark.
The distance to the subject is greater
than 2.1 meters in Telephoto or
greater than 2.7 meters in Wide-
angle.
Get closer to your subject and shoot. P.33
The subject is blackish. Correct exposure. (Exposure correction
also changes the light quantity of the
flash.)
P. 5 2
The image is too bright. The light quantity of the flash is not
appropriate.
Move a little away from the subject or
light up the subject for shooting without
flashing.
P. 3 3
It is over-exposed. Use exposure compensation. Cancel
Exposure Time.
P. 5 2
P. 6 8
The brightness of the LCD monitor is
not appropriate.
Adjust the brightness of the LCD
Monitor.
P. 9 8
The image is too dark. The shot was taken in a dark place
while set to (Flash Off).
Deselect the Flash Off with the F button. P.33
It is under-exposed. Use exposure compensation. Set to
Exposure Time.
P. 5 2
P. 6 8
The brightness of the LCD monitor is
not appropriate.
Adjust the brightness of the LCD
Monitor.
P. 9 8
The image lacks natural
color.
The picture was shot in conditions
that are hard for Auto White Balance
to adjust to.
Add a white object to the composition.
Or use a White Balance setting other
than Auto.
P. 5 3
The date, or recording
information does not
appear.
The screen display function is set to
No Display.
Press the DISP. button and switch
display.
P. 2 4
The brightness of the LCD
Monitor changes during
AF.
You are using it in a dark place or
when Auto Focus range and
surrounding brightness are different.
This is normal. -
There is a vertical smear
on the image.
This is a phenomenon that occurs
when a bright subject is shot. It is
called the smear phenomenon.
This is normal. -

Ricoh Caplio R1V Specifications

General IconGeneral
Megapixel5 MP
Camera typeCompact camera
Sensor typeCCD
Image sensor size1/2.5 \
Maximum image resolution2560 x 1920 pixels
Still image resolution(s)640 x 480, 1280 x 960, 2048 x 1536, 2560 x 1920
Optical zoom- x
Focal length range4.6 - 22.2 mm
Lens structure (elements/groups)9/7
InterfaceUSB 1.1, AV out
Digital SLRNo
Built-in flashYes
Camera shutter speed1 - 1/2000 s
Focal length (35mm film equivalent)28 - 135 mm
Normal focusing range0.3 - ∞ m
Auto focusing (AF) modescentre weighted auto focus, spot auto focus
Macro focusing range (tele)0.13 - ∞ m
ISO sensitivityAuto
Flash modesFlash off, Red-eye reduction, Slow synchronization
Flash range (tele)0.13 - 2.1 m
Flash range (wide)0.2 - 2.7 m
Motion JPEG frame rate30 fps
Video formats supportedAVI
Maximum video resolution320 x 240 pixels
Display diagonal1.8 \
Display resolution (numeric)110000 pixels
Product colorGold
Battery typeDB-50
Battery life (CIPA standard)490 shots
Compatible memory cardsmmc, sd
Scene modesDocuments, Night, Portrait, Sports, Landscape (scenery)
White balanceauto, daylight, Fluorescent, Tungsten
Weight and Dimensions IconWeight and Dimensions
Depth25 mm
Width100.2 mm
Height55 mm
Weight150 g
